Course Description
This course introduces students to the fundamental concepts of mechanics through engaging, hands-on activities and projects. From understanding forces and motion to building simple machines like levers, pulleys, and gears, students will gain a practical understanding of how mechanical systems work. Each session emphasizes key principles in physics and engineering, fostering curiosity and honing problem-solving skills.
The course includes the Mechanics Maverick kit, offering 15+ exciting hands-on activities. Explore gears, levers, and more while building and testing your own machines—an enjoyable and interactive way to learn real-world physics and foundational STEM concepts!

Curriculum Outline
Lesson 1: Force
Introduction to the concept of force, exploring different types such as push and pull, and understanding how forces interact with objects.
Lesson 2: Motion
Discover the concept of motion, including types like linear, circular, and periodic, with real-life examples to illustrate these principles.
Lesson 3: Wheel & Axle
Learn how the wheel and axle function as simple machines, reducing friction and aiding movement in various applications.
Lesson 4: Lever
Explore the mechanics of levers, understanding how they provide mechanical advantage and are used in tools and machinery.
Lesson 5: Pulley
Understand the basics of pulleys, their components, and how they make lifting easier in daily life and industrial applications.
Lesson 6: System of Pulleys
Delve into multiple pulley systems to gain mechanical advantage, building your own pulley system and analyzing its efficiency.
Lesson 7: Catapult
Construct a catapult to explore potential and kinetic energy, energy transfer, and projectile motion in a hands-on experiment.
Lesson 8: Gears - Part 1
Learn about gears, including types and basic two-gear systems, understanding how gears of the same size transfer motion at the same speed.
Lesson 9: Gears - Part 2
Study the effects of gear size and arrangement, exploring how changing gear sizes can increase or decrease speed and direction.
Lesson 10: Gears - Part 3
Investigate complex multi-gear systems, understanding how they affect speed, direction, and torque in advanced mechanical arrangements.
Lesson 11: Pneumatic System
Discover the principles of air pressure and how pneumatic systems use it for tasks like lifting and pressing through fluid pressure transmission.
Lesson 12: Hydraulic System
Learn about fluid pressure in hydraulic systems and how they use liquid compression to transmit force in applications like hydraulic presses.
Lesson 13: Center of Mass
Explore the concept of the center of mass, how it affects balance, and how mass distribution impacts an object’s stability.
Lesson 14: Thrust
Understand thrust and its role in propulsion, experimenting with methods of thrust generation and its applications in real-world scenarios.
Lesson 15: Toy Dissection Project
Dismantle a toy to analyze its internal mechanisms, identifying components like gears, springs, wheels, and axles, and understanding how they work together.
Tangible Outcome
Upon completing this course, students will have a comprehensive understanding of mechanical principles, including forces, motion, and energy transfer. They will have built various simple machines and mechanisms, and completed a toy dissection to explore real-world applications, fostering a deeper understanding of engineering and physics.
Skills Honed
- Fundamental Understanding of Mechanics: Grasp essential physics concepts like force, motion, and energy transfer, and how they apply to everyday objects.
- Hands-On Construction of Simple Machines: Build and explore simple machines, such as levers, pulleys, gears, and catapults, developing practical engineering skills.
- Problem-Solving and Experimentation: Engage in experiments and hands-on projects to explore concepts like balance, mechanical advantage, and energy transformation.
- Application of Pneumatics and Hydraulics: Learn about pneumatic and hydraulic systems, gaining insight into fluid dynamics and pressure applications in machinery.
- Analytical Skills Through Disassembly: Develop analytical skills by dissecting a toy to understand its internal mechanisms, identifying the roles of different components in mechanical systems.
